What are DRO and Impact Forces of South Africa Metal Oxide Quantum Dots Embedded in Silica Market?
Drivers, Restraints, and Opportunities (DRO) constitute the core analytical framework used in market research to systematically evaluate the factors promoting or hindering market expansion, and the potential avenues for future growth. Impact Forces refer to significant, often external or sudden, macroeconomic or geopolitical shifts—such as rapid technological breakthroughs or new government regulations—that fundamentally alter the market landscape and competitive dynamics beyond traditional trends.
What is Impact of U.S. Tariffs on South Africa Metal Oxide Quantum Dots Embedded in Silica Market?
The primary impact of US tariffs on specialized materials like metal oxide quantum dots is felt through global supply chain disruption and increased cost of imported components used in South African electronics and solar manufacturing sectors. While South Africa may not be the direct target, reliance on globalized supply chains for precursor materials and manufacturing equipment sourced from tariff-affected regions leads to higher procurement costs, potentially slowing the adoption rate of these advanced quantum dots.
How is AI currently impacting South Africa Metal Oxide Quantum Dots Embedded in Silica Market?
Artificial Intelligence is currently driving industrial transformation globally by optimizing complex processes, particularly in advanced materials synthesis and quality control. AI algorithms are utilized to accelerate the discovery of novel quantum dot formulations, enhance manufacturing consistency and yield, and provide real-time predictive maintenance in high-precision production environments, thereby reducing waste and accelerating time-to-market for innovative applications.
